Postby Albys on Tue Sep 04, 2007 7:03 am

Thanks TheMC5!
I'm happy for your words and for you (great) dynasty with my roster.

Uhm, in real life Marvin Williams have only a 24.4% from 3pt (11/45), Josh Smith have 25% (38/152)... i think my 3pt setting in game (48 for both) is real, maybe 50-52 max.

I think that has to do with a few main points:
1. Marvin Williams played a lot less than Josh Smith last season, therefor had less 3pt attempts
2. Williams is asked to play inside more than Smith, and I just feel like if Williams played outside more, he'd get more 3 pointers than Smith.
3. 11/45 is a pretty small sample size

Also, I could be wrong, but I seem to remember Williams being a pretty decent 3pt shooter in college. But it's not a big deal anyway. I always just do a few tweaks to ratings with every roster.

Realistic Roster 2.3 released :!: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------

New Features v. 2.3:

- NBA Teams real rosters updated at 24-09-2007, with all real trade/deal.
- Updated some overall players after FIBA competitions Aug.-Sept 07.
- Added Guillermo Diaz in Clippers and Ian Mahinmi in FA.
- Added new jerseys: Denver 66 home, Indiana 67 home, Toronto 1995 home & away.
- Updated all real contracts!
- Updated all shoe’s for players traded!
- Updated all real numbers!
- Various overall players fix for best performance.
- Added various players cyberfaces & portraits.
- Updated some starting five.
- Real Spalding NBA ball!

It is compatible with the Real Shoes patch and SUM v1 and v2
